The Italian Federation informed on Romeo Sacchetti’s roster for the National Team’s two last FIBA World Cup Qualifiers.

By John Askounis/ info@eurohoops.net

Italy still needs one win to advance to the FIBA World Cup through Europe’s qualifiers. The Azzurri will host Hungary on February 22nd and if needed will seek their clinching “W” facing Lithuania on the road three days later. Ultimately, one win in either match will be enough for a trip to China next summer.

Romeo Sacchetti named Awudu Abass, Pietro Aradori, Paul Biligha, Ariel Filloy, Diego Flaccadori, Alessandro Gentile, Riccardo Moraschini, Davide Pascolo, Giampaolo Ricci, Brian Sacchetti, Stefano Tonut, Luca Vitali and Michele Vitali members of his squad for the upcoming FIBA National Team window.

AX Armani Exchange Olimpia Milan’s Jeff Brooks, Andrea Cinciarini and Amedeo Della Valle will first be available for their club’s EuroLeague Regular Season Round 23 game, before joining their National Team in Varese for the match against Hungary.

Christian Burns, Leonardo Candi, Riccardo Cervi, Simone Fontecchio, Pierpaolo Marini, Andrea Pecchia and Achille Polonara will also be available if needed.
